Arborist Crew Leader

3 weeks ago


Innisfil, Canada Bartlett Tree Experts Full time
Summary

Are you an experienced Arborist looking to take your career to the next level? As an Arborist Crew Leader, you will be an integral member of the team, serving as the leader of a tree care crew with the primary responsibility of performing all tree care services safely and efficiently. This is a unique opportunity to share your passion for tree care by enhancing the skills, performance, and productivity of other team members within your office. 

Benefits

We offer competitive compensation, as well as:

  • A safety-first culture and professional workplace
  • Advancement opportunities - we promote from within
  • Life, LTD, ADD, medical and dental
  • RPP Plan, Healthcare spending account, and paid vacation and holidays
  • Industry credential/license pay increases
  • Company-paid uniforms, PPE, gear, and equipment
  • Boot reimbursement up to $200
  • Access to training, continuing education programs, and a variety of resources provided by the Bartlett Tree Experts Research Laboratories

To find out more about what life is like at Bartlett, check us out on Instagram @LifeatBartlett. 

Responsibilities

As an Arborist Crew Leader, you will play an important role in:

  • Safely performing and supervising all aspects of arboriculture, including:
    • Pruning
    • Cabling and bracing
    • Rigging
    • Removals
    • Properly maintaining and operating equipment (hand tools, chainsaws, chippers, and aerial lifts)
  • Bringing a cooperative and enthusiastic attitude to the job site
  • Supervising and managing crews while performing tree care services, as directed by the Arborist Representative and Local Manager
  • Ensuring that each crew member is trained appropriately for each designated job assignment
  • Ensuring that all tree care work is performed in accordance with industry and company standards
  • Communicating, answering questions, and building relationships with clients
Qualifications
  • A passion for nature, the environment, and the outdoors
  • At least three (3) years of tree climbing (DdRT or SRT) and aerial lift experience in the tree care industry
  • Valid driver's license and clean motor vehicle record (Class B CDL preferred)
  • Ability to work outdoors year-round in all weather conditions
  • Proven initiative, positive attitude, team-oriented, and self-motivated
